Prepare for Payroll Tax Hikes to Replenish Unemployment Insurance Funds

In response to the COVID-19 pandemic, state unemployment insurance (UI) benefits, funded through payroll taxes, were exhausted. As a result, employers’ UI payroll taxes could double over the next two to three years, benefits advisors predict.
